Ejector Pump Installation in Huntsville, AL
Ejector pump installation is a service that helps manage wastewater and sewage in properties where gravity drainage is insufficient. This system is designed to lift waste from lower levels or basement bathrooms, directing it to the main sewer line. Projects typically involve installing ejector pumps in homes with below-grade bathrooms, laundry rooms, or other plumbing fixtures that require elevation to connect to the main sewer system. Property owners often want to understand the scope of installation, including the placement of the pump, the necessary plumbing modifications, and the maintenance requirements to ensure reliable operation.
Before requesting ejector pump installation, homeowners should consider the size and capacity of the pump needed for their property’s specific wastewater flow. It’s also important to evaluate the existing plumbing setup and any potential space constraints for installation. Understanding the long-term maintenance needs and whether any electrical or structural modifications are required can help ensure the system functions effectively. Proper planning and professional assessment can help property owners make informed decisions about installing an ejector pump to support their plumbing needs.

Ejector Pump Installation Questions
What is an ejector pump used for? An ejector pump helps remove wastewater from basement bathrooms, laundry rooms, or other below-grade areas where gravity drainage isn't possible.
How do I know if an ejector pump is needed? If plumbing fixtures are located below the main sewer line, an ejector pump may be necessary to ensure proper drainage and prevent backups.
What types of properties typically require ejector pump installation? Ejector pumps are common in homes with finished basements, commercial buildings, or properties with below-grade plumbing fixtures.
What should property owners consider before installing an ejector pump? Proper placement, sizing, and connection to existing plumbing are important factors to ensure reliable operation and prevent issues.
